Magnus Groß e3a320eec0 Continue parsing cmdline arguments in the desktop file
In a56904e40d the desktop file was patched
to use "wezterm start" instead of "wezterm". As an unneeded addendum
that patch also included the unnecessary addition of ending command-line
parsing by passing the "--" option at the end.

As it turns out, some consumers of wezterm's desktop file want wezterm
to parse command line flags. For example KDE's kio passes the whole
cmdline via the "-e" flag, because it is widely used for most terminal
emulators as the primary mean of passing the cmdline.

To solve this we remove the unneeded "--" again, because we now also
support the "-e" option.
After all, all trailing arguments will automatically be parsed by
wezterm as the cmdline of the program to run.
The only sideeffect of this change is that we now cannot longer start
programs that share a name with a "wezterm start" option, for example if
the user has installed an executable at /usr/bin/--always-new-process
then this edge case will not work anymore.
Given that this would be an extremely unlikely scenario, it makes more
sense to improve compatibility by supporting the usecase of passing the
cmdline with the "-e" flag.

[Desktop Entry]
Name=WezTerm
Comment=Wez's Terminal Emulator
Keywords=shell;prompt;command;commandline;cmd;
Icon=org.wezfurlong.wezterm
StartupWMClass=org.wezfurlong.wezterm
TryExec=wezterm
Exec=wezterm start --cwd .
Type=Application
Categories=System;TerminalEmulator;Utility;
Terminal=false
